Understanding Spherical Roller Ball Bearings
Spherical roller ball bearings are a type of rolling-element bearing that can accommodate misalignment between the shaft and housing. Unlike traditional bearings, these specialized components allow for both radial and axial loads, making them a preferred choice in various industrial applications. Their unique design features spherical inner and outer raceways, which enable the rollers to align themselves within the races, thus providing a self-aligning capability that enhances their operational efficiency.
The Design and Construction of Spherical Roller Ball Bearings
Key Components of Spherical Roller Ball Bearings
1. **Inner Ring**: The inner ring houses the roller elements and is mounted directly onto the shaft.
2. **Outer Ring**: The outer ring forms the outer raceway and is generally fixed within the housing.
3. **Rollers**: The spherical rollers are designed to distribute loads evenly, reducing stress on each component.
4. **Cage**: The cage guides the rollers and maintains their spacing, ensuring efficient movement.
How Spherical Roller Ball Bearings Differ from Other Bearings
Spherical roller bearings stand out due to their ability to handle both radial and axial loads in both directions, unlike standard ball bearings that typically only accommodate radial loads. Additionally, their self-aligning feature greatly reduces the risk of wear and tear caused by misalignment, which is a common issue in high-load applications.
Benefits of Using Spherical Roller Ball Bearings
1. Enhanced Load Capacity
Spherical roller ball bearings are engineered to support heavy loads while maintaining high performance levels. Their unique roller configuration allows for optimal load distribution, which significantly reduces the likelihood of bearing failure under extreme conditions.
2. Self-Alignment Capabilities
The inherent design of spherical roller ball bearings allows them to self-align, which is crucial in situations where equipment may experience misalignment due to thermal expansion, wear, or installation errors. This feature not only reduces maintenance costs but also extends the lifespan of the bearing and associated equipment.
3. Superior Durability and Reliability
Constructed from high-quality materials, spherical roller ball bearings are designed to withstand harsh environments. Their resistance to wear, corrosion, and fatigue makes them a reliable choice for industries such as mining, construction, and manufacturing.
4. Reduced Friction and Heat Generation
With their smooth rolling action, spherical roller bearings minimize friction and heat generation. This characteristic helps maintain optimal operating temperatures, which is essential for the longevity of both the bearings and the machinery they support.
5. Versatility in Application
Spherical roller ball bearings are used in a myriad of applications, from heavy machinery and industrial motors to automotive and aerospace sectors. Their adaptability makes them suitable for various operating conditions, including high speeds and varying loads.
Applications of Spherical Roller Ball Bearings
1. Heavy Machinery
In construction and mining equipment, spherical roller ball bearings are critical for ensuring reliable performance under heavy loads and harsh conditions. They provide the necessary support for components such as gearboxes, motors, and driveshafts.
2. Agricultural Equipment
These bearings are widely used in agricultural machinery like tractors and harvesters, where they effectively handle the dynamic loads encountered during operation. Their durability ensures minimal downtime and maintenance costs.
3. Automotive Industry
In vehicles, spherical roller ball bearings play a vital role in axles, transmissions, and suspension systems. Their ability to support both radial and axial loads enhances vehicle stability and performance.
4. Wind Turbines
Spherical roller bearings are increasingly used in wind turbines, where their self-aligning properties improve reliability and reduce maintenance. They can withstand the variable winds and loads experienced in renewable energy applications.

Maintenance Tips for Spherical Roller Ball Bearings
1. Regular Inspection
Conduct regular inspections to ensure that the bearings are operating correctly. Check for signs of wear, lubrication levels, and any misalignments that may affect performance.
2. Proper Lubrication
Using the right type of lubricant is crucial for the longevity of spherical roller ball bearings. Ensure that lubrication is applied according to the manufacturer's specifications, as inadequate lubrication can lead to premature failure.
3. Monitoring Temperature and Vibration
Implement monitoring systems to track temperature and vibration levels. Sudden changes may indicate underlying issues that require immediate attention.
4. Replacement Guidelines
Be aware of the typical lifespan of spherical roller ball bearings and establish a replacement schedule based on operating conditions and manufacturer recommendations to prevent unexpected failures.
